Nah - They'll eat in full sun. Voraciously. I am one of those awful people that thinks of them as pests. I grow tomatoes for tomatoes, not hornworms. And I don't call this particular moth a hummingbird moth, although many do. It is a sphinx moth. And so I destroy them.
Scroll down the page for various photos of hummingbird moths and sphinx moths.
http://www.whatsthatbug.com/clearwing_moth.html
The moth you photographed, although a sphinx moth, appears to be one of the clear-winged sphinx moths in the genus Hemaris. Their caterpillars are quite different in appearance from those of the tobacco/tomato hornworms - see http://extension.missouri.edu/explore/agguides/pests/ipm1019clearwingedsphinx.htm for an example.
